Company Overview

Alfa Laval AB is a Swedish industrial technology company that develops products and systems for heat transfer, separation and fluid handling. Its equipment is used to improve energy efficiency, support production processes and manage fluids across a range of industrial and commercial applications.

The company’s product portfolio includes heat exchangers, centrifugal separators, decanters, pumps, valves, fluid-processing equipment and related systems. Alfa Laval serves customers in industries such as energy, food and beverage, pharmaceuticals, chemicals, wastewater treatment and marine transportation. Its technologies are also used in applications involving renewable energy, emissions reduction and resource recovery.

Founded in Sweden in 1883 by inventor Gustaf de Laval, the company has developed from an engineering business focused on separation technology into a global provider of process equipment and solutions. Alfa Laval serves customers through operations, sales networks and service activities across multiple regions, including Europe, North America, Asia and other international markets. The company is headquartered in Lund, Sweden.

Alfa Laval's stock was trading at $50.1480 at the beginning of 2026. Since then, ALFVY stock has increased by 14.5% and is now trading at $57.4350.

Alfa Laval AB Unsponsored ADR (OTCMKTS:ALFVY) posted its earnings results on Tuesday, July, 21st. The company reported $0.52 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.62 by $0.10. The firm had revenue of $1.87 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$1.87 billion. Alfa Laval had a trailing twelve-month return on equity of 18.41% and a net margin of 11.63%.
